PG4UWMC
Command line parameters
Program PG4UWMC supports following command line parameters:
/prj:<file_name>
Loads project file. Parameter <file_name> means full or relative project file path and name.
There is also available to make Load project operation from command line by entering project
file name without prefix /prj:...
Example:
pg4uwmc.exe c:\projects\myproject.eprj
Makes load project file "c:\projects\myproject.eprj".
/autoconnectsites
The command forces PG4UWMC to connect programmer Sites (start control program
PG4UW for each Site) during start of PG4UWMC, for all Site-s that were used, when
PG4UWMC was recently closed. There is also equivalent option "Auto-connect Sites"
available in "Settings" dialog of PG4UWMC.
Programmers supported by PG4UWMC
The list of currently supported programmers can be displayed in PG4UWMC by menu Help |
Supported programmers. Generally, supported programmers in PG4UWMC are 48-pin
universal programmers with USB interface. Also all of our USB connected multiprogramming
systems are supported. PG4UWMC can handle from 1 to 8 programmer sites. One
programmer site means one ZIF socket module.
Troubleshooting
Serial numbers
For successful using of multiply programmers, correct serial numbers must be specified for
each used programmer in panel Serial numbers. If there is empty field for serial number,
application PG4UW for the programmer Site won't start.
When PG4UWMC application is searching for connected programmers in "Search for
programmers" dialog, serial numbers of programmers are detected automatically. User does
not need (and can not) specify serial numbers by himself.
Communication error(s) while searching for programmers
If some kind of communication error(s) occurs, please close all PG4UW applications and
PG4UWMC and then start PG4UWMC and click button "Connect programmers" to start
PG4UW applications for each Site and connect programmers.
All programmers are connected correctly but unstable working
If communication with programmers is lost randomly during device operation (for example
device programming), please close other programs, especially programs which consumes
large amount of system resources (multimedia, CAD, graphic applications and so on).
Note:
We also recommend to use computer USB ports placed on back side of computer and
directly connected to motherboard, because computer USB ports connected to computer
motherboard indirectly - via cable, may be unreliable when using high speed USB 2.0 transfer
modes. This recommendation is valid not only for programmers, but also for other devices.
